
Senior Frontend Developer – Transaction Management Platform
Clara
full-time
Posted on:
Location Type: Remote
Location: Mexico
Visit company websiteExplore more
Job Level
Tech Stack
About the role
- Build and maintain microfrontend applications within a federated architecture using Module Federation and Rsbuild/Rspack, ensuring seamless integration with the host container application.
- Develop complex financial workflows including transaction detail views, multi-level approval flows, receipt processing pipelines, and bulk action interfaces.
- Design and implement state management solutions using custom store patterns, React Query for server state, and URL-synchronized search/filter engines — no Redux required; we favor lightweight, purpose-built patterns.
- Work across a TypeScript monorepo (pnpm workspaces) containing a main React application and shared core packages (API client, selectors, receipt processing engine, search logic).
- Build real-time features using WebSockets (STOMP/SockJS) for live transaction updates and optimistic UI patterns.
- Contribute to the internal component library and design system built on top of MUI v5 and Emotion, ensuring consistency across the platform.
- Collaborate on code quality through ESLint, Prettier, TypeScript strict mode, SonarCloud analysis, and thorough PR reviews.
Requirements
- 5+ years of experience in frontend development, with a focus on React
- Strong proficiency in JavaScript, TypeScript, and component-based architecture
- Hands-on experience consuming RESTful APIs and working with testing frameworks
- Familiarity with Git, Agile methodologies (Scrum, Kanban), and modern development workflows
- Experience ensuring accessibility, responsiveness, and consistent styling across web applications
- Ability to mentor junior engineers and support team development
- Working proficiency in English and Spanish
- Self-driven, impact-focused, and adaptable to change
Benefits
- Competitive salary and stock options (ESOP) from day one
- Multicultural team with daily exposure to Portuguese, Spanish, and English (our corporate language)
- Annual learning budget and internal accelerated development paths
- High-ownership environment: we move fast, learn fast, and raise the bar — together
- Smart, ambitious teammates — low ego, high impact
- Flexible vacation and hybrid work model focused on results
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
JavaScriptTypeScriptReactMicrofrontend architectureModule FederationRsbuildRspackWebSocketsRESTful APIsState management
Soft Skills
MentoringCollaborationAdaptabilityImpact-focusedCommunication